What is it like to travel the world as a Black queer couple?

In this episode of El Cafecito Travel Talks, Tony sits down with Ash and Phae, two slow travellers from the United States who share their experiences navigating the world while embracing multiple identities. From defining what “non-binary” and “queer” mean in their own words to discussing safety, community, and the realities of long-term travel, this conversation is thoughtful, honest, and approachable.

The discussion also explores Ecuador’s LGBTQ+ history, the importance of finding welcoming communities, and why slow travel has given them a new sense of freedom.

Whether you’re part of the LGBTQ+ community or simply curious to learn from different perspectives, this episode is about travel, understanding, and human connection.
